Welcome to the Pixelbarn on-call rotation. A known memory leak exists in the Thumbcache layer: plugins that request decoded images without releasing their handles cause the cache to grow unbounded, eventually triggering OOM restarts. If you author a plugin, always pair acquire and release calls, even on error paths. Leak symptoms, heap-dump instructions, and the mitigation flag are all documented for plugin authors on the internal page directly below this note.

operations page: https://vault.qirvanhq.local/ticket

### Account Recovery — Catalogue Import (Lintwood)

Quick one for review: when the Lintwood catalogue import wipes a patron's session table, the recovery flow re-seeds accounts from the nightly snapshot. Check that the importer skips locked accounts — last time it didn't. To rerun recovery against staging you'll need the vault passphrase, which is appended just below.

recovery phrase for yafof-tajof: julmir-kelax-julvan-holath-belvan-holir-ralael-ralvan-ralath-julvan-silmir-istmir-kaswyn-ulamir

## Limits & Quotas

Welcome to the Murmur Gallery audio-guide team! The app streams narration clips, so we cap concurrent streams per visitor and throttle downloads on museum wifi to keep things smooth during school-trip rushes. Most quotas live in one config module. The values currently in production are these.

tuning table, bawip-bahap:
BUDGETS = {
    "gorir": 473,
    "kelius": 138,
    "silion": 345,
    "aldmir": 429,
    "tamdor": 108,
    "oliir": 987,
    "belius": 539,
}